Job Description
- The candidate will be responsible for planning, developing, implementing, and evaluating human resource policies and programmes.
- The candidate will be expected to provide advice to managers and employees on the interpretation of human resources policies, benefit programmes, and collective bargaining agreements.
- The candidate will be expected to negotiate collective bargaining agreements on behalf of employers or employees.
- The candidate must conduct research and prepare occupational classifications, job descriptions, and salary scales.
- The candidate must coordinate employee performance and appraisal programmes.
- The candidate will be expected to conduct research on employee benefits and health and safety practises and make recommendations for changes.
- The candidate will be expected to hire, train, and supervise employees.
- The candidate must review, evaluate, and implement new administrative procedures.
